Transaction d229906ac613b9abff65aeac60cc1757be38fb4bff3db2d915923e1d97f012cc

1 Input
1 Outputs
  • d229906ac613b9abff65aeac60cc1757be38fb4bff3db2d915923e1d97f012cc:0
  • value  23730700
    address  3Ez8oZKL43XwiBjVen4cNZG9DShdhBqmrv